Condividi tramite


Export-DebugLogs

Raccoglie ed esporta Microsoft Purview Information Protection file di log client e scanner in un file compresso.

Sintassi

Export-DebugLogs
      [-FileName] <String>
      [-OnBehalfOf <PSCredential>]
      [<CommonParameters>]

Descrizione

Il cmdlet Export-DebugLogs raccoglie tutti i file di log client e scanner da %localappdata%\Microsoft\MSIP\Logs e li salva in un singolo file compresso con un formato .zip . Questo file può quindi essere inviato a supporto tecnico Microsoft se si richiede di inviare file di log per analizzare un problema segnalato con il client Microsoft Purview Information Protection o scanner da questo client.

Usare il parametro OnBehalfOf se è necessario esportare i file di log da un account del servizio. Ad esempio, un account creato per l'esecuzione non interattiva, ad esempio l'account per lo scanner di Information Protection MicrosoftPurview.

Esempio

Esempio 1

PS C:\> Export-DebugLogs -FileName C:\Logs\AIPLogs.zip

Questo comando raccoglie e salva tutti i log esportati nel file AIPLogs.zip nella cartella C:\Logs esistente.

Parametri

-FileName

Percorso e nome file per i file di log esportati.

Il percorso può essere locale o un percorso di rete (lettera di unità mappata o UNC).

Tutte le cartelle nel percorso devono già esistere. Se si specifica un nome di file già presente nella cartella specificata, il file originale viene sovrascritto.

Quando si specifica il nome del file, includere l'estensione del nome file .zip .

Tipo:String
Posizione:0
Valore predefinito:None
Necessario:True
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

-OnBehalfOf

Per usare questo parametro, è necessario eseguire la sessione di PowerShell con l'opzione Esegui come amministratore .

Specifica la variabile che include l'oggetto credenziali da usare quando è necessario esportare i file di log da un account diverso dall'account con cui si esegue l'accesso. Ad esempio, è necessario raccogliere i file di log per l'account del servizio che esegue lo scanner Microsoft Purview Information Protection. In questo scenario, se lo scanner viene installato nello stesso computer in cui si esegue questo cmdlet, i file di log includono anche alcune informazioni dal database di configurazione dello scanner.

Usare il cmdlet Get-Credentials per creare la variabile che archivia le credenziali.

Tipo:PSCredential
Posizione:Named
Valore predefinito:None
Necessario:False
Accettare l'input della pipeline:False
Accettare caratteri jolly:False

Input

None

Output

System.Object

Note